We are looking for a Senior Producer & Content Manager to:
- Strategically deliver Sadler's Wells' digital content across our Digital Stage programme, website, YouTube channel and partnerships.
- Assist the Department director with the curation of and oversee the creation of artistic and factual digital content that inspires and engages existing and potential dance audiences, encouraging them to experience, enjoy and participate in dance. This includes artistic work for Sadler's Wells Digital Stage, participatory content for our Take Part programme, and content that helps global audiences to discover dance.
- Produce the 2nd edition of Dance Digital, Sadler's Wells film festival and manage our short dance film open-call commissions application and production process.
You Will Have The Following Skills And Experience:
- A strong track record of project managing the end-to-end production and release of high-quality content in the creative industries.
- Experience of managing live events.
- Experience managing teams.
- Excellent planning, organisation and communication skills, with experience collaborating with artists and other stakeholders.
- A data-driven and audience-centric approach to distributing and optimising digital content across multiple platforms and in a variety of formats.
- A commitment to championing accessibility and inclusion in all your work.
This role would suit a senior digital and live event producer who is interested in developing and delivering the next chapter of digital content for global audiences at Sadler's Wells.
